Two and a half weeks ago, AD experienced a stressful situation that caused him to lose sleep for two consecutive nights.
Following this, he developed muscle weakness in his shoulder, which extended down to his left forearm. I advised him to consult his cardiologist, but unfortunately, he did not follow through. Instead, he took a pain reliever to ease the soreness in his left arm. This initially brought some relief, but after several days, the muscle weakness, fatigue, soreness, and achiness in his left arm returned.
At that time, he did not report any chest pain, chest heaviness, shortness of breath, lightheadedness, or nausea. However, about a week later, while at the mall, he experienced sudden paleness of his lips, chest heaviness, and shortness of breath. This time, the pain radiated from his jaw to his shoulder and extended down to his left forearm. Believing the pain might be due to a dental issue, he contacted his dentist, who prescribed another pain reliever. When that brought no relief, I strongly advised him to see his cardiologist Dr. James Ho and his nephrologist Dr. Agnes Mejia as soon as possible.
He was eventually taken to the ER by his househelp, where several laboratory tests were conducted. Doctors determined that he needed to be admitted for close observation and further testing, as he was experiencing a myocardial infarction (heart attack).
It's important to note that a myocardial infarction and a stroke, while both serious cardiovascular events, are not the same. A heart attack involves a blockage of blood flow to the heart muscle, whereas a stroke results from a blockage of blood flow to the brain. However, both conditions require immediate medical attention.
